What is aromatherapy?
Aromatherapy uses essential oils (concentrated plant extracts) to create scent experiences that engage the senses and can influence mood. You can experience them by inhaling the aroma through a diffuser, applying a rollerball to your pulse points, enjoying a bath with a few drops of bath oil, or using a body or hand and body oil.
Some oils, like tea tree or lavender, have been studied for mild effects on the skin itself, such as temporary relief for minor irritations. However, beyond that, applying oils is mostly about enjoying the fragrance.
Certain scents are commonly associated with different effects: lavender is often perceived as calming, citrus as uplifting, and frankincense as grounding. Scientific studies suggest that smells can influence mood and perception, though responses vary between people.
Exploring the new Evolve aromatherapy range
Evolve’s collection is built around something they call the Bioenergetic Wheel, inspired by seasonal rhythms and the science of neurophysiology. The idea is simple: our energy needs can be grouped into four core states – Energise, Nurture, Calm, Detox – and each of the new blends is designed to meet one of those needs.
The products themselves are very versatile. You’ll find aromatic essences (undiluted essential oil blends for diffuser or carrier oils), handy pulse point roll-ons for on-the-go use, and indulgent bath and body oils. There are even matching hand and body washes and lotions so you can carry a scent through your daily routines. Prices range from £14 for a rollerball to £28 for a body oil. Here’s a closer look at the four blends:
Joyful Light (Energise)
This one’s all about bottling daylight. A bright mix of neroli, sweet orange, and litsea sets the tone (citrusy, fresh, mood-lifting)with ylang ylang and petitgrain. It’s the kind of scent you’d want to smell when you need some extra motivation, inspiration, or just a lift out of the mid-afternoon slump.
Wild Divine (Nurture)
Described as a celebration of the “divine feminine,” Wild Divine is a softer, more nurturing blend. Rose Otto sits at the centre, long associated with the heart and emotional healing. Around it are palmarosa, rose geranium, sweet orange, and a surprising touch of cacao. The effect is floral with a warm, almost edible undertone. It feels supportive, sensual, and comforting all at once.
Zen Whisper (Calm)
As the name suggests, Zen Whisper is about switching gears into relaxation mode. It’s comprised of lavender (a classic for sleep and stress relief), with frankincense, vetiver, marjoram, and bergamot. If you’re winding down in the evening or running a bath, this would be the scent to reach for.
Vital Clarity (Detox)
Vital Clarity is a bright, citrus-herb blend made from lemon, grapefruit, basil, rosemary, and black pepper. The combination gives it a fresh, zesty aroma with subtle herbal undertones. According to Evolve, it’s designed for moments when you want to feel more alert or focused.

About Evolve Beauty
If you haven’t come across this lovely brand before, Evolve is a British beauty brand founded in 2009 by Laura Rudoe. It’s known for small-batch, organic products that do what they promise without compromising on values. Vegan, cruelty-free, and B Corp certified, its ethos is grounded in transparency and sustainability. Even the packaging choices (recycled glass, card, and PET) speak to the eco-conscious mindset.
But beyond credentials, Evolve has always been about blending nature with results. Its skincare formulas highlight the percentage of organic content and hero natural actives, so there’s no slathering on “green beauty” as a label just because. The new aromatherapy range takes their ingredient-first approach and extends it into the territory of mood, energy, and emotional balance.
